1. Introduction
1.1 Background
Taylor’s University is one of the top private universities in Selangor, Malaysia. It is ranked #251 in QS World University Rankings 2025 and #41 in Asia.
Established in 1969, Taylor’s University has grown from a humble college into a renowned international university. It was founded as Taylor’s College, providing a platform for Malaysian students to pursue internationally recognized pre-university programmes. Over the years, Taylor’s expanded its academic portfolio, including an array of undergraduate and postgraduate programmes, and in 2010, it achieved university college status.
The university has marked several significant milestones in its journey. In 2011, it moved to a new, modern lakeside campus and, in 2012, was officially promoted to a full-fledged university. Known for its strong focus on teaching, learning, and a student-centered approach, Taylor’s University has consistently been recognized for its teaching excellence and student satisfaction. The university’s strategic collaborations with international institutions and industry leaders have further elevated its profile.
Here’s key statistics about Taylor’s University:
- 15,000 students enrolled at Taylor’s.
- 25%-30% of students are from 80+ different countries.
- 16:1 student-to-faculty ratio.
- 80%-95% of teaching faculty are PhD holders.
- 99% graduate employability rate
1.2 Taylor’s University Ranking 2025
According to the 2025 QS World University Rankings, Taylor’s University ranks #251 (2024: #284) globally and ranks #36 (2024: #41) among the top universities in Asia, a testament to its commitment to providing world-class education. It also ranks #7 in Southeast Asia where the university resides.
Below are Taylor’s University’s QS rankings by Subject that made it on the QS Subject Rankings:
| QS Subject Category | Subject World Ranking |
| Hospitality and Leisure Management | #20 |
| Marketing | #51-100 |
| Data Science and Artificial Intelligence | #51-100 |
| Art and Design | #51-100 |
| Business and Management Studies | #112 |
| Accounting and Finance | #101-150 |
| Architecture and Built Environment | #101-150 |
| Social Sciences and Management | #135 |
| Economics and Econometrics | #180 |
| Pharmacy and Pharmacology | #151-200 |
| Communication and Media Studies | #201-250 |
| Arts and Humanities | #148 |
| Computer Science and Information Systems | #201-250 |
| Education and Training | #251-300 |
| Sociology | #301-375 |
| Engineering – Electrical and Electronic | #351-400 |
| Medicine | #451-500 |
| Engineering and Technology | #401-450 |
| Engineering – Mechanical | #501-575 |

How Is Student Life At Taylor’s University?
Location and Surrounding Vibe: Taylor’s University operates its huge flagship campus, aptly called The Lakeside Campus, for its beautiful man-made lake as the cornerstone of the campus grounds. The campus is located in Subang Jaya, Selangor, Malaysia, situated near the scenic Sunway Lagoon theme park and surrounded by lush greenery. The campus exudes a tranquil and peaceful vibe, providing an ideal setting for students to focus on their studies. The nearby Sunway Pyramid shopping mall also offers a variety of dining and entertainment options for students to unwind after classes.
Ease of Accessibility to Campus: It is easily accessible via public transportation such as the Sunway BRT buses network and KTM / LRT trains, and even its own bus shuttle, making it convenient for students to commute from different areas. The surrounding area is filled with numerous food outlets, supermarkets, and other amenities, providing students with a vibrant and lively atmosphere.
Security on Campus: The campus has stringent security measures in place to ensure the safety of all students and staff. The Lakeside Campus has 24-hour security guards patrolling the campus.
Student Diversity: Taylor’s University prides itself on its diverse student population, with students from over 80 countries studying at the university. The top three countries with the highest number of international students are China, Indonesia, and Vietnam. This diversity provides a rich cultural exchange for students, allowing them to learn and appreciate different cultures and perspectives.
2.2 Learning Resources
Faculty Learning Resources & Facilities: Simulated clinical and hospital wards for healthcare training; mock courtrooms for legal battles; industry-standard tools and equipment for architecture, design, and creative arts; professional kitchens and culinary labs; fully designed hotel rooms; broadcasting studios; and entrepreneurial hubs for mentorship and discussions.
General Learning Resources & Facilities: State of the art large capacity lecture theatres, abundant computer labs, expansive 4-storey library, e-learning technology for blended studies, Me-reka 3D printing makerspace, collaborative and self-directed learning with X-Space classrooms and VX learning theatres.
2.3 Recreational Facilities
Basketball court, netball court, table tennis, badminton court, indoor swimming pool, performing arts space, and multipurpose halls for various activities.
2.4 Student Activities
Taylor’s University boasts a thriving campus life with numerous active clubs and societies spanning an array of interests. There are cultural and international clubs, academic societies, community service clubs, arts and performance clubs, entrepreneurship clubs, and sports and outdoor clubs.
There are also competitions and tournaments regularly organised by the clubs or faculties, workshops and skill-building sessions, industry talks and career events through its Taylor’Sphere programme.
2.5 Student Services
One of Taylor’s University’s outstanding student services is its award-winning Career Support Service. The in-house career team provides career counselling, career interest profiling, resume review, mock interviews and connects students to hundreds of potential employers!

It also provides international student support to smoothen the integration and immersion of any foreign students experiencing Malaysia for the first time.
The university even incorporates physical access, special arrangements and customised support for students with special needs under its Special Needs Access Plan.
2.6 Taylor’s University Student Accommodation
On-Campus: Taylor’s University provides several comfortable accommodation options, designed to suit a variety of student needs. On-campus accommodation, such as the U Residence and the Ruemz Hotel, offers fully-furnished, air-conditioned rooms, with amenities like mini-fridges and study desks. They ensure easy access to classes and campus resources, creating a conducive at-home study environment.


Off-Campus: Nearby off-campus accommodations include a variety of affordable condominiums and apartments, such as Dk Senza, D’latour, Sunway Court, and Union Suite which are well-connected to the university via public transport and are close to various community amenities.
Accommodation Costs: The range of accommodation costs at the university varies considerably, depending on the type and location of the accommodation. On-campus accommodations typically range from RM1,200 to RM2,200 per month, while off-campus options can range from RM600 to RM1,500 per month, depending on the property and the number of roommates.
Living Cost: General cost of living, excluding accommodation, for students studying on-campus typically ranges between RM800 and RM1,200 per month. This would cover expenses like food, transportation, books, and miscellaneous personal expenses. Please note, these are estimates and actual costs may vary based on individual lifestyle and choices.

A unique proposition in the university’s course combinations comes from the Taylor’s Curriculum Framework (TCF) where essentially you get the flexibility to mix-and-match modules and electives. For example, majoring in Engineering while minoring in Culinary Arts. Not every university is able to cater to contrasting specialisations.

3.3 Taylor’s University Scholarships
These are some of the popular scholarships offered by Taylor’s University. Click here to see the full list of scholarships:
| Scholarships | Details |
| Taylor’s Excellence Award | Quantum based on academic results. |
| Taylor’s Merit Scholarship | 50%-100% tuition fee waiver based on academic and extracurricular achievements. |
| Taylor’s Sports Scholarship | 50%-100% tuition fee waiver for state or national athletes. |
| Taylor’s Community Scholarship | Full scholarship covering tuition fees for outstanding students who are below a certain family income level. |
| Taylor’s Talent Scholarship | 50%-100% tuition fee waiver for students with special talent and good academic results. |
PTPTN Financial Aids
Malaysian students can apply for the National Higher Education Fund or PTPTN which is responsible for giving loans to students pursuing tertiary education. PTPTN falls under the purview of the Ministry of Higher Education.
You can borrow from RM3,400 to a maximum RM50,000 per annum depending on the level and type of course you are taking. PTPTN only charges an annual interest rate of about 1%.
3.4 Popular Courses Review At Taylor’s University
Pre-University – Cambridge A-Level & SACE
Taylor’s University is one of the pioneer institutions in Malaysia offering A-level and the SACE certification (South Australian Certification of Education) making it one of the most established in terms of track record in producing quality pre-university graduates. Many have gone on to over 200 reputable universities worldwide including Ivy League universities.
Since their introduction, Taylor’s have produced 3,800 A-level graduates and 5,800 SACE graduates. Taylor’s A-Level students have earned multiple Cambridge Learner Awards for outstanding exam results and more than 50% of SACE students scored ATAR 80 and above.
A-level lecturers have at least 7 years of teaching experience, with 50% serving as CAL examiners with international subject experts conducting regular workshops. Over 50% of SACE lecturers have taught SACEi for over 5 years, and most have participated as examiners in Australia.
Business, Accounting & Finance Courses
One of the reputation Taylor’s University has built for itself is the dynamic and entrepreneurial spirit of its business courses. Imbued with the focus on practical exposure, students are exposed to industry guest lectures, workshops, industry site visits, projects to launch your own business, create actual marketing plans for industry partners, pitch to fund your startup, get mentorship from experienced veterans and much more.



It is no surprise that Taylor’s is ranked #91 under the QS World University Rankings for the field of study of Business and Management category.

Communications And Media Studies Courses
Mass Communications is also a field of study that Taylor’s University is well regarded for. You can choose to have several specialisations into Digital Media Production, Advertising and Branding, Public Relations Marketing.
The School of Media and Communications have strong ties with the media, public relations and advertising industry. Its list of partners include global companies such as Leo Burnett, Ogilvy & Mather, Group M, Edelman Public Relations, Sony Malaysia, Media Prima, Astro, The Star Media, The Edge Publications, Aljazeera International and many more.



The School also runs an on-campus consultancy programme called proPassion Communications which is run by final year students. Students have been given the opportunity to experience handling real world clients such as Shopee, Digi, Dutch Lady, Baskin Robbins, Escape Room and the list goes on.
Taylor’s is ranked within the Top 250 under the QS Ranking for the subject category of Communications and Media Studies
Hospitality and Culinology Courses
The hospitality and tourism is one of Taylor’s University’s highest achievement by subject category as it ranks #17 globally in the QS World University Rankings. The campus is equipped with all the facilities such as hotel front desk, and hotel rooms designed to specification.
Naturally, students will be placed into actual working environments with industry partners such as Hilton, Shangri-la, Mandarin Oriental, Westin, Intercontinental, Accor Group and more.
Students graduating from the hospitality degrees will receive a dual award both by Taylor’s University and the University of Toulouse-Jean Jaurès, FRA.



Its Culinology and Patisserie courses are also highly popular with students. The term Culinology was coined by Taylor’s as it infuses not just culinary arts but also culinary technology.
The campus is equipped with more than one industrial grade kitchen and several casual and fine dining restaurants for students to train and be put to the test. Actual customers can walk-in and order off a menu.
Budding chefs from the School of Food Studies and Gastronomy has swept the winning Gold Prize at the Young Chef Olympiad competition several times. This is an international competition involving contestants from more than 40 countries.
Architecture and Interior Architecture Courses
Architecture students from Taylor’s are constantly in demand as the industry knows how well-trained the students are. It is ranked in the Top 200 globally in the QS World University Rankings under the subject category of Architecture and Built Environment.



Students under the Architecture and Interior Architecture courses receive alot of hands-on exposure through multiple project assignments. Student teams are known to sleep in the on-campus workshop to finish the architecture models within the deadline. There will also be competitions, field trips, site visits and technical visits to learn how construction and project management are handled and applied.
Taylor’s is the first private university to be recognised by the Board of Architects Malaysia (Lembaga Arkitek Malaysia or LAM), reflecting the well-crafted and refined syllabus over the years.
Computing & IT Courses
Computing studies at Taylor’s rank in the Top 350 in QS World University Rankings under the Computer Science and Information category.



Its undergraduate courses are incorporated with projects to design your own product with technological and entrepreneurship potential. Students will be able to gain experience in developing technology that solve real world problems. One example is a win by students from the School of Computer Science for their creation – Taylor’s students swiped 5 of 12 awards at i-MSC competition for developing mobile applications and websites
Students taking the degree courses will graduate with a dual award from Taylor’s University and the University of the West of England, UK.
Psychology Course
The Psychology course at Taylor’s quickly raised in ranking over the last few years to clinch the #169 spot in the QS World University Rankings. This is a reflection of the continuous investment the university has made into improving the level of learning, faculty and research in this space.


Students get access to the latest research equipment and tests at the Centre of Human Excellence & Development via selected modules. The syllabus is adapted to ever-changing behaviour and environment of today and covers Neuroscience, Cyber-Psychology, Online Identity and Behaviour, and more.
The number of students it accepts under this course is limited every year to maintain its quality of education and therefore it is generally high in demand.
Philosophy, Politics and Economics Course (NEW!!)
In December 2024, Taylor’s University launched Malaysia’s first undergraduate course combining the disciplines of philosophy, politics and economics. The aim of this course is to equip students with a holistic world view and the ability to think critically on issues that affect a nation on a micro and macro level through the lens of government policies, economic plans and geo-political dynamics.
The skills acquired is meant to be applied in any kinds of industries and sectors but is also perfect for careers in consulting, finance, think-tanks, NGOs, public service, and academia.



Why is this course so relevant? It is backed by a strong Industry Advisory Panel, led by Professor Dr Ong Kian Ming, Taylor’s University’s Pro Vice-Chancellor for External Engagement and former Member of Parliament (MP), as well as other distinguished figures such as Keluar Sekejap Podcast Co-host, Former Minister and UMNO Youth Chief Khairy Jamaluddin, Former MP and Political Secretary to the Finance Minister Tony Pua, The Edge Media Group Executive Chairman Tan Sri Tong Kooi Ong, and University of Nottingham Malaysia Associate Professor, The Institute for Democracy and Economic Affairs (IDEAS) Former Chief Executive Officer (CEO) Dr Tricia Yeoh, among many others.
3.3 Industry Partners
Taylor’s University has established partnerships with a wide range of companies and organisations to provide students with practical experience, industry exposure, and networking opportunities. These partnerships play a significant role in shaping students’ skills, knowledge, and employability in various industries.

Examples of industry partners that contribute to students’ project assessments and internship opportunities include PwC, HSBC, Unilever, PAM, IBM, Microsoft, WPP, Ogilvy, Media Prima, Astro, Shangri-La Hotels, Hilton Worldwide, AECOM, Gamuda, Shell, Sunway Healthcare, IHH Healthcare, learning centres and international schools.
3.4 University Partners
Taylor’s University also boasts an international network of over 200 university partners that students can easily transfer to whether by twinning partnerships, student transfer or exchange programmes. These universities come from the European region, North America, South America and Oceania countries.
4. Entry Requirements & Intake Dates
4.1 Taylor’s University Entry Requirements 2025
Minimum entry requirements for Foundation:
- SPM – 5 credits
- IGCSE – 5 credits
(Including credit for Maths and English)
Minimum entry requirements for Diploma:
- SPM – 3 credits
- IGCSE – 3 credits
(Including pass for Maths and English)
Minimum entry requirements for Degree:
- UEC – 5B
- STPM – CGPA of 2.00
- A-Level – 2D
- SACE/WACE – ATAR 60
- IB Diploma – 24 points in 6 subjects
- Foundation – CGPA 2.00
- Diploma – CGPA 2.00
Please note that the entry requirements may vary depending on the chosen field of study as certain courses will require specific minimum results for certain subjects. For example, if you intend to study Taylor’s University’s MBBS, you need to enter Foundation with a minimum of 5B which must include Biology, Chemistry, Physics and Mathematics / Additional Mathematics.
4.2 Taylor’s University Intake Periods For 2025
The intake periods for Taylor’s University in 2025 are as follows:
- Foundation – Feb, Apr, Aug
- Diploma – Apr, Aug
- Degree – Feb, Apr, Jun, Sep
- Postgraduate – Feb, Apr, Jun, Sep, Oct
Please note that the intake periods may vary depending on the course but the majority of the intake periods will fall in the months shown above. For specific intake dates, click here.
